Ondo Finance, a leading tokenized real-world asset (RWA) issuer, has announced the launch of Ondo Chain—a new Layer 1 blockchain designed to accelerate the development of institutional-grade financial markets on-chain. This strategic move marks a significant expansion in Ondo’s ecosystem, aiming to bridge the gap between traditional finance and decentralized infrastructure.
The new blockchain combines the security and compliance features of permissioned systems—commonly used by financial institutions—with the openness and accessibility of public blockchains like Ethereum. By doing so, Ondo Chain seeks to create a trusted, scalable environment where regulated assets can be issued, traded, and managed with greater efficiency and transparency.

Bridging Traditional Finance and Decentralized Innovation
Ondo Chain is engineered to meet the rigorous standards required by institutional investors while remaining open to developers and innovators. The platform enables seamless integration between on-chain and off-chain financial systems, reducing operational costs, improving settlement speed, and enhancing overall security.
“Financial markets are long overdue for an upgrade,” said Nathan Allman, CEO of Ondo Finance. “Ondo Chain is built to uphold the highest institutional standards while staying open to developers and innovators. It tightly integrates on-chain and off-chain infrastructure to reduce costs, enhance security, and ultimately deliver a better user experience.”
This hybrid design allows Ondo Chain to support regulated financial products without sacrificing decentralization or accessibility—a critical balance for attracting both Wall Street players and Web3 builders.
Key Features of Ondo Chain
Ondo Chain introduces several advanced capabilities tailored for institutional use:
- Permissioned Validators: Trusted entities will validate transactions and ensure data accuracy, including real-time asset pricing and proof of token-backed reserves. This model enhances trust while maintaining regulatory compliance.
- Staking with Tokenized Real-World Assets: Users can stake tokenized bonds, equities, or other RWAs directly on the network to help secure the chain—unlocking yield opportunities without requiring native utility tokens.
- Native Cross-Chain Bridge: A built-in interoperability layer enables seamless transfer of assets between Ondo Chain and other supported networks, facilitating liquidity flow across ecosystems.
These features position Ondo Chain as a foundational layer for future financial applications that require both regulatory alignment and technical innovation.
Major Institutions Join the Ecosystem
Several prominent financial institutions have already signaled their support for Ondo Chain, including Franklin Templeton, Wellington Management, and WisdomTree. These partners will provide strategic input into the blockchain’s governance and technical design, ensuring it meets real-world institutional needs.
Their involvement underscores growing confidence in blockchain-based financial infrastructure among traditional asset managers. As more institutions explore digital asset strategies, platforms like Ondo Chain offer a compliant, secure pathway to on-chain operations.
Expanding the RWA Ecosystem: Ondo Global Markets
In parallel with the blockchain launch, Ondo Finance recently introduced Ondo Global Markets, a new platform enabling investors to gain on-chain exposure to over 1,000 securities listed on the New York Stock Exchange and Nasdaq. This includes individual equities and fixed-income ETFs.
“Ondo Global Markets will do for securities what stablecoins did for the U.S. dollar,” Ondo stated earlier this week. The platform aims to bring the benefits of blockchain—such as 24/7 trading, faster settlement, and programmable finance—to traditional asset classes.
By tokenizing these instruments, Ondo Global Markets lowers entry barriers for global investors and opens new avenues for fractional ownership and automated portfolio management.

Strong Market Position Backed by Data
According to DeFiLlama, Ondo Finance currently manages over $653 million in total value locked (TVL), reflecting strong adoption of its existing RWA products. This positions Ondo as one of the top players in the rapidly growing tokenized asset sector.
The launch of Ondo Chain is expected to further boost TVL by enabling new types of financial applications—from on-chain money market funds to decentralized bond exchanges—built on a compliant, high-performance base layer.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
What is Ondo Chain?
Ondo Chain is a new Layer 1 blockchain developed by Ondo Finance to support institutional-grade financial applications. It blends permissioned validation for compliance with public blockchain accessibility for developers.
How does Ondo Chain differ from other blockchains?
Unlike most public chains, Ondo Chain incorporates regulated financial standards, allowing institutions to participate securely. It also supports staking with real-world assets and offers native cross-chain interoperability.
Who is backing Ondo Finance?
Major financial institutions such as Franklin Templeton, Wellington Management, and WisdomTree are actively involved in shaping Ondo Chain’s development and governance.
What are tokenized real-world assets (RWAs)?
Tokenized RWAs are digital representations of physical or traditional financial assets—like bonds, stocks, or real estate—on a blockchain. They enable fractional ownership, increased liquidity, and automated management.
Can anyone build on Ondo Chain?
Yes. While designed for institutional use, Ondo Chain remains open to developers. Its architecture supports smart contracts and decentralized applications focused on compliant financial services.
Is Ondo Chain related to Ethereum?
Ondo Chain is an independent Layer 1 but maintains compatibility with Ethereum’s tooling and ecosystem standards. Its native bridge allows seamless asset transfers between networks.
